Synopsis
IBM Java is affected by multiple vulnerabilities.
Description
The version of IBM Java installed on the remote host is prior to 7.0 < 7.0.10.70 / 7.1 < 7.1.4.70 / 8.0 < 8.0.6.15. It is, therefore, affected by multiple vulnerabilities as referenced in the Oracle July 14 2020 CPU advisory.
  - Vulnerability in the Java SE, Java SE Embedded product of Oracle Java SE (component: Libraries). Supported     versions that are affected are Java SE: 8u251, 11.0.7 and 14.0.1; Java SE Embedded: 8u251. Difficult to     exploit vulnerability allows unauthenticated attacker with network access via multiple protocols to     compromise Java SE, Java SE Embedded.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in unauthorized     update, insert or delete access to some of Java SE, Java SE Embedded accessible data as well as     unauthorized read access to a subset of Java SE, Java SE Embedded accessible data. Note: Applies to client     and server deployment of Java. This vulnerability can be exploited through sandboxed Java Web Start     applications and sandboxed Java applets. It can also be exploited by supplying data to APIs in the     specified Component without using sandboxed Java Web Start applications or sandboxed Java applets, such as     through a web service. (CVE-2020-14556)
  - Vulnerability in the Java SE, Java SE Embedded product of Oracle Java SE (component: JSSE). Supported     versions that are affected are Java SE: 7u261, 8u251, 11.0.7 and 14.0.1; Java SE Embedded: 8u251.
    Difficult to exploit vulnerability allows unauthenticated attacker with network access via TLS to     compromise Java SE, Java SE Embedded.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in unauthorized     read access to a subset of Java SE, Java SE Embedded accessible data. Note: Applies to client and server     deployment of Java. This vulnerability can be exploited through sandboxed Java Web Start applications and     sandboxed Java applets. It can also be exploited by supplying data to APIs in the specified Component     without using sandboxed Java Web Start applications or sandboxed Java applets, such as through a web     service. (CVE-2020-14577)
  - Vulnerability in the Java SE, Java SE Embedded product of Oracle Java SE (component: Libraries). Supported     versions that are affected are Java SE: 7u261 and 8u251; Java SE Embedded: 8u251. Difficult to exploit     vulnerability allows unauthenticated attacker with network access via multiple protocols to compromise     Java SE, Java SE Embedded.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in unauthorized ability to     cause a partial denial of service (partial DOS) of Java SE, Java SE Embedded. Note: Applies to client and     server deployment of Java. This vulnerability can be exploited through sandboxed Java Web Start     applications and sandboxed Java applets. It can also be exploited by supplying data to APIs in the     specified Component without using sandboxed Java Web Start applications or sandboxed Java applets, such as     through a web service. (CVE-2020-14578, CVE-2020-14579)
  - Vulnerability in the Java SE, Java SE Embedded product of Oracle Java SE (component: 2D). Supported     versions that are affected are Java SE: 8u251, 11.0.7 and 14.0.1; Java SE Embedded: 8u251. Difficult to     exploit vulnerability allows unauthenticated attacker with network access via multiple protocols to     compromise Java SE, Java SE Embedded.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in unauthorized     read access to a subset of Java SE, Java SE Embedded accessible data. Note: Applies to client and server     deployment of Java. This vulnerability can be exploited through sandboxed Java Web Start applications and     sandboxed Java applets. It can also be exploited by supplying data to APIs in the specified Component     without using sandboxed Java Web Start applications or sandboxed Java applets, such as through a web     service. (CVE-2020-14581)
  - Vulnerability in the Java SE, Java SE Embedded product of Oracle Java SE (component: Libraries). Supported     versions that are affected are Java SE: 7u261, 8u251, 11.0.7 and 14.0.1; Java SE Embedded: 8u251.
    Difficult to exploit vulnerability allows unauthenticated attacker with network access via multiple     protocols to compromise Java SE, Java SE Embedded. Successful attacks require human interaction from a     person other than the attacker and while the vulnerability is in Java SE, Java SE Embedded, attacks may     significantly impact additional products.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in takeover     of Java SE, Java SE Embedded. Note: This vulnerability applies to Java deployments, typically in clients     running sandboxed Java Web Start applications or sandboxed Java applets, that load and run untrusted code     (e.g., code that comes from the internet) and rely on the Java sandbox for security. This vulnerability     does not apply to Java deployments, typically in servers, that load and run only trusted code (e.g., code     installed by an administrator). (CVE-2020-14583)
  - Vulnerability in the Java SE, Java SE Embedded product of Oracle Java SE (component: 2D). Supported     versions that are affected are Java SE: 7u261, 8u251, 11.0.7 and 14.0.1; Java SE Embedded: 8u251. Easily     exploitable vulnerability allows unauthenticated attacker with network access via multiple protocols to     compromise Java SE, Java SE Embedded. Successful attacks require human interaction from a person other     than the attacker and while the vulnerability is in Java SE, Java SE Embedded, attacks may significantly     impact additional products.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in unauthorized creation,     deletion or modification access to critical data or all Java SE, Java SE Embedded accessible data. Note:
    This vulnerability applies to Java deployments, typically in clients running sandboxed Java Web Start     applications or sandboxed Java applets, that load and run untrusted code (e.g., code that comes from the     internet) and rely on the Java sandbox for security. This vulnerability does not apply to Java     deployments, typically in servers, that load and run only trusted code (e.g., code installed by an     administrator). (CVE-2020-14593)
  - Vulnerability in the Java SE, Java SE Embedded product of Oracle Java SE (component: JAXP). Supported     versions that are affected are Java SE: 7u261, 8u251, 11.0.7 and 14.0.1; Java SE Embedded: 8u251. Easily     exploitable vulnerability allows unauthenticated attacker with network access via multiple protocols to     compromise Java SE, Java SE Embedded.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in unauthorized     update, insert or delete access to some of Java SE, Java SE Embedded accessible data. Note: This     vulnerability can only be exploited by supplying data to APIs in the specified Component without using     Untrusted Java Web Start applications or Untrusted Java applets, such as through a web service.
    (CVE-2020-14621)
Note that Nessus has not tested for these issues but has instead relied only on the application's self-reported version number.
Solution
Apply the appropriate patch according to the Oracle July 14 2020 CPU advisory.
